{"title":"The Black Sea Russian Navy Is Not an Overnight Creation – A Brief History of the Black Sea Russian Navy","authors":"Lucian valeriu Scipanov, Florin Nistor","doi":"10.55535/rmt.2022.3.10","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.55535/rmt.2022.3.10","url":null,"abstract":"\"The maritime power of a state is not built overnight. That is the result of a long process based on articulated strategies, the needs of a state to defend and promote its maritime interests, and it depends on the economic power as well as the maritime ambition. In this regard, it must be said that the Russian Federation Black Sea Fleet has not appeared from nowhere. It has had a step-by-step strategy with relevant presence and military actions having significant strategic influences in the region. As part of this endeavour, a presentation will be made on the emergence, evolution, and modernisation of the Black Sea Fleet, in relation to the geopolitical realities and regional interests of the Russian Federation. Thus, the purpose of this approach is to identify the principles that underpin the promotion of a maritime strategy in the Black Sea region, in relation to the peculiarities of a semi-enclosed sea, and how they influence the development of the fleet. The novelty is determined by some important lessons learned. One of the main tasks of naval strategy in peacetime is to obtain sufficient space for the operations of one’s naval forces and aircraft in times of war, so the size, configuration, and strategic position of the coast in a Narrow Sea do matter. Having this relevant example, we can highlight some characteristics of the centuries-old strategy for the development of Russian maritime power (especially that of the Black Sea) and its projection capacity in the World Ocean. From these conclusions, the Black Sea littoral states, members of NATO, can extract some lessons to be capitalised on. As a result of this analysis, we can underline the fact that, throughout history, the states involved could learn to win more through war than through peace.\"","PeriodicalId":137367,"journal":{"name":"Romanian Military Thinking","volume":null,"pages":null},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2022-09-01","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"133568720","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

{"title":"Influence Operations, between the Ethical and Critical Facet","authors":"Angela-Karina Avădănei","doi":"10.55535/rmt.2022.3.05","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.55535/rmt.2022.3.05","url":null,"abstract":"\"The psychological operations (PSYOPS) doctrines of many NATO member states, including Romania, do not allow the use of influence activities on internal audiences. While this is an ethical provision, difficulties arise when formulating an adequate counter-propaganda strategy, as domestic groups that are susceptible to influence are targeted by an effective propaganda conducted by the adversary. The 2014 edition of the NATO doctrine on PSYOPS (psychological operations) was ambiguous with regard to this limitation, while the Romanian doctrine from 2016 kept it, in accordance with the older NATO doctrine from 2007. With this limitation PSYOPS risk being ineffective in countering propaganda, their role being restricted to analysing the effects of the propaganda on the audiences and making recommendations to counter it. Without using influence activities, the recommendations would be, based on the scenario, addressing the public or not (choosing “silence”) with information activities through the responsible structures. Going further, inform and influence activities (IIA) intertwine, which leads to the need for more clarity in the doctrines that regulate their employment. The propaganda of the Russian Federation in Donbas, that victimised the separatists leading to their support for the invasion of Ukraine is a relevant example for situations when PSYOPS should be allowed to target internal audiences. The present paper does not go into detail on the case of Ukraine but problematises on the above-mentioned ethical limitation that has the advantage of giving the adversary advantages on multiple levels.\"","PeriodicalId":137367,"journal":{"name":"Romanian Military Thinking","volume":null,"pages":null},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2022-09-01","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"133137528","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

{"title":"Satellite Navigation Systems – An Avoided Target?","authors":"Dorian Luparu","doi":"10.55535/rmt.2022.3.04","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.55535/rmt.2022.3.04","url":null,"abstract":"\"In the current geopolitical context, the Black Sea region has become the scene of the conflict in which a wide range of weapons and ammunition are used. It is their directing/guiding by using signals transmitted by satellite navigation networks – GNSS that categorically makes the difference. Their contribution can be instantly noticed, even though it is not a novelty. The weapons that benefited from the augmentation of the satellite signal proved the accuracy of their shots. This is the reason why the actions of jamming or falsification of the satellite signal appeared in the battlefield and even threats of GNSS attack were launched. In the present article, I intend a disambiguation of the subject, in an attempt to delimit military declarations from political ones, in the space environment, which has become essential in the conduct of modern military actions.\"","PeriodicalId":137367,"journal":{"name":"Romanian Military Thinking","volume":null,"pages":null},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2022-09-01","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"121588323","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}
